Hoyer Statement on 2018 House Floor Schedule
WASHINGTON, DC – House Democratic Whip Steny H. Hoyer (MD) issued the following statement today after the House legislative schedule for calendar year 2018 was released:
“Today, House Republicans released the legislative schedule for 2018. It is my hope that they will use our limited time in session next year in a more productive manner than they have this year. Republicans have wasted this year on failed attempt after failed attempt to repeal the Affordable Care Act – a goal that the American people do not share. As a result, they have not achieved any real accomplishments for the people we represent. Congress still needs to fund the government for the remainder of the fiscal year, provide assistance to our fellow citizens recovering from natural disasters, protect DREAMers, and act to stabilize health insurance markets that have been harmed by Republicans’ sabotage efforts. Instead, with only a few weeks left in session, House Republicans are pursuing a partisan tax bill to give massive tax cuts to the wealthy while raising taxes on the middle class and exploding the deficit.
“Next year, House Republicans should choose to work with Democrats rather than continuing to pursue everything in a partisan fashion, which has only exposed their deep divisions and mired the House in chaos and dysfunction. The House needs to take action on the issues Americans care about, including promoting economic growth and job creation so that all of our people can Make It In America.”
